I'd resend the DV. I would omit the date of visit, the balance, your SSN, and the OC, but I would include your name, your address at the time (if applicable), and would include any of the CA's identifying account numbers as listed on their dunning letter.
If "date of visit", then is this medical? There are two routes if this is medical (and I'd take yours). One is to send a DV then a PFD if you agree. The other is to follow the HIPAA process which would involve completely ignoring the CA and paying the OC instead.
